History of All Saints, Castle Camps

Listed Building

C13 origin. C15 nave and west tower. Restorations of 1850, 1855, 1876-1880 … Monuments: south wall of nave, reset, Thomas Wakefield (1610); Sir James Reynolds (1717) standing wall monument of white and grey marble sarcophagus with pyramid.
